BROCKPORT, NY- The Brockport Field hockey team will wrap up conference play at St. John Fisher on Wednesday, October 29th, at 4 pm.
Last Outing: The Golden Eagles punched their ticket to the Empire 8 Tournament with a 2-1 win over Utica on Saturday, October 25th. The Green and Gold improved to 8-8 overall and 5-4 in conference play following the victory.
Freshman
Elise Brady continued her excellent season, notching two clutch goals to pace the Brockport offense in the win. Brady now leads the Green and Gold with eight goals on the season.
Katelynn Banning (W, 3-4) provided her best outing of the season, making eight saves with just one goal allowed.
Cassidy Pado and
Terralyn McLaughlin each provided an assist on the afternoon.
Postseason Scenarios: The Golden Eagles have clinched an Empire 8 postseason berth, currently holding sixth place. Brockport would move up to the No. 5 seed with a win over St. John Fisher on Wednesday.
Leading the Pack: Leading the squad with eight goals and 17 points,
Elise Brady has been red hot down the stretch for the Green and Gold. The freshman from Orchard Park, NY, has racked up nine points (4G, 1A) across her last four outings, recording a shot on goal or better in six of her last eight games.
Scouting St. John Fisher: The Cardinals currently hold the #4 seed in the Empire 8 standings, posting a 6-3 record in conference play. Brockport will look to defeat St. John Fisher for the first time since the 20212 season.
Up Next: The Golden Eagles will hit the road for the Empire 8 Conference Tournament on Saturday, November 1st, with the location, time, and opponent still to be determined.
